Shibuya Guitars Station/ [The unique pickup that Mateus Asato sought] In 2015, two years after acquiring his iconic Shell Pink Classic S Antique guitar, Mateus Asato took the opportunity to replace the bridge pickup from an SSV with the release of the Thornbucker, which has received rave reviews from numerous artists, and has continued to captivate us with his many performances. In 2017, John Suhr began designing the Mateus Asato Signature Guitar and at the same time began developing the Mateus Asato Signature Pickup, which would respond to his musical sensibilities. The SSV-style wound coil produces a soft attack and smooth, warm sound, and the same Alnico IV magnet as the bright, wide-range Thornbucker combine to create a pickup that fully expresses his musical vision. Since the release of the Mateus Asato Signature Guitar, many guitarists have been requesting it to be added to their custom guitar pickup options and sold separately, and in response, it was finally released as the Asatobucker in 2020.
